https://www.youtube.com/live/H_1XfornjLU?si=0ofa4I0PAilKqO8O Talking Guitar: Jas Obrecht's Music Magazine recently posted a 41-year-old audio interview with Queen guitarist Brian May, in which he recounts the unique studio jam session that led to the creation of the blues-infused EP, Star Fleet Project. The interview, recorded in 1983, took place while the EP was still in its planning stages. In the conversation, Brian explains the science-fiction-inspired theme of the project, highlighting how his love for the blues—particularly his admiration for Eric Clapton—shaped its sound. He also shares how his young son's enthusiasm for a Saturday morning TV show served as a major influence. Brian provides rare insights into working with Eddie Van Halen, reflecting on their collaboration outside of Van Halen. “Exclusively Van Halen" is the ultimate destination for all things Van Halen. Lee and Billy welcome Danny McCluskey, Co-owner of The Alternate Root, Desert Roots Music and a thirty-year-plus veteran of the music industry. From 1979 to 1985 he wrote and developed radio shows, developed programming and organized the yearly local music event ‘The Rock and Roll Rumble' for legendary radio station WBCN in Boston, Massachusetts. In 1985, Danny joined Atlantic Records, handling services for Island and Virgin Records when under the Atlantic umbrella, as promotion manager for the Boston / New England region where he remained until 1990. Moving on to San Francisco in 1990, Danny managed a publicity firm, The Madera Group. He started his own firm, Next Step Promotion and Publicity in 1996 which later became Next Step Music Management handling artist management, music supervision, publishing and artist development. Songs With Vision started operations in 2002 focusing on film and television music placement for labels and independent artists and acting as a Music Supervisor for a number of film projects as well as in-house for Hallmark Films. Songs With Vision joined forces with The Artist Development Group in 2007, going on to form The Media Guide, The Alternate Root magazine, ADC Films, Alternate Root TV, and other arms of The Alternate Root. The common factor in all the endeavors has been music. In this episode of The Truth In This Art Beyond: New Orleans, host Rob Lee interviews Jan Ramsey, the founder of Offbeat Magazine. Join them as they delve into the world of New Orleans music and the role that Offbeat plays in showcasing the unique culture of the city and state.About Jan RamseyJan has been passionate about New Orleans as the most musical and interesting city in America for over 30 years, and has built Offbeat into the bible of the New Orleans music scene. With its goal of representing the music and culture to locals and readers all over the world, Offbeat strives to be honest in its editorial content and to help its clients' businesses succeed.Join Rob and Jan as they discuss Jan's personal goal of converting everyone to appreciate and treasure the unique culture of New Orleans, and her long-term goal of making sure that Offbeat continues its mission as a cultural icon. They will also touch on Jan's dream of establishing a world-class music museum in New Orleans, and the role that Offbeat plays in promoting and showcasing the city's music and arts.This episode is a must-listen for anyone interested in the vibrant music scene of New Orleans and the power of media to promote and preserve cultural heritage.About Offbeat MagazineOffBeat is a New Orleans, Louisiana monthly local music magazine founded by Jan V. Ramsey in 1987. The magazine, published by OffBeat, Inc., focuses on the popular music of New Orleans and Louisiana, which is generally R&B, blues, jazz, rock, hip-hop, funk, and many other traditional styles of music popular in Louisiana. OffBeat was the first magazine in New Orleans to resume publishing after the devastation of Hurricane Katrina, despite losing all its staff and its printer.OffBeat publishes several music festival oriented issues, including the "French Quarter Festival Souvenir Guide" in early April, and the "Jazz Fest Bible," a special Jazz Fest issue. These issues contain schedules of local music festivals, detailed information on performers and club listings, and interviews with local musicians. The magazine hosts a local music awards series, "The Best of the Beat Awards", to highlight local music and musicians, and also runs the "Louisiana Music Directory," containing listings of bands, musicians, record labels, and clubs in the state.The magazine's website was the first magazine website online in the state of Louisiana.OffBeat is featured in the HBO series Treme. 2500 DelMonte Street: The Oral History of Tower Records
Ep. 29 Mike Farrace (PULSE! Magazine)

2500 DelMonte Street: The Oral History of Tower Records

Play Episode Listen Later Dec 13, 2022 63:19


Before he started working for Tower Records Watt Avenue in 1975, today's guest Mike Farrace had already run a Sacramento music magazine called “Rock & Roll News”. Following three years working at Tower Records Watt Avenue under Store Manager Mike Koontz, Farrace started working for Tower Advertising. Mike tells us all about his time as Northwest Advertising Ad Manager, chasing down labels and blank tape companies for advertising dollars. Yet the whole time he was in Advertising, Farrace was thinking about starting up a Music Magazine that would be a Tower in house exclusive. Spending a year submitting proposals to John Schairer, he was finally told by Carla Henson “Mike, he's just throwing those [proposals] in the trash.” Next, Mike Farrace went straight to Russ Solomon and within 20 minutes at lunch, they were plotting out what would eventually become PULSE! Magazine, an independent publication that reflected Tower Records, its customers and the music it sold in the best possible way. The first 3 issues were put together by Farrace himself and over the course of 222 issues it eventually built up an impressive in house staff. When PULSE! started it was the old fashioned paste up method of putting a magazine together. It wasn't for several years until PULSE! got into computer graphics typesetting/publishing. But that simple, convenient move got Mike Farrace thinking and reading about a digital future. This led to Tower having its first database store online which led to Tower selling music on the internet. Mike also tells us about the only time an artist got pissed at PULSE!, and how it was all Mike's fault. Later in our discussion Mike recalls seeing the end coming for Tower and how things ended for PULSE! and himself in 2002.
